Output d959b296ff8ea32d3826fb2702b34476295683993b6a6035660bb8d793efd586:125

value
76486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e9ddffe2bb61988cf0b547529aafd090501352 OP_EQUAL
address
3Bz3mQV2An4bnTwZtPunnjH5UFBuBFrEYS
transaction
d959b296ff8ea32d3826fb2702b34476295683993b6a6035660bb8d793efd586
spent
true